Mojang Studios has inadvertently unveiled intriguing details regarding the much-anticipated Minecraft LIVE 2024 event, scheduled for a live stream on September 28 at 1 PM EDT (10:30 PM IST). This event promises to provide a sneak peek into the future of Minecraft, showcasing its evolving roadmap. According to a report by IGN, Microsoft has hinted at several exciting features, including a new biome, a potentially horror-themed mob, and the introduction of a “Hardcore” game mode.

Minecraft Live 2024 Leaked Details: What to Expect

The revelation came to light when a Reddit user, ozzAR0th, discovered an update on the Minecraft Live website that featured a ‘Watch the Highlights’ section. This section was presumably intended to showcase highlights after the event concluded. The page invited viewers to “Get the latest and greatest news from this year’s show,” hinting at an array of new content.

Among the highlights mentioned was a first look at the “pale garden” and its accompanying hostile mob, known as the “creaking.” However, specifics regarding this new biome and its menacing inhabitant remain shrouded in mystery. Additionally, the showcase is expected to delve into insights about bundles and the much-discussed Hardcore mode.

Moreover, attendees can anticipate further details on the eagerly awaited Minecraft Movie, which has been generating buzz within the community. A teaser trailer for the film has already piqued interest, offering a glimpse into what fans can expect.

In addition to these revelations, Mojang is likely to introduce an immersive experience titled Minecraft Experience: Villager Rescue during the event, adding another layer of excitement for fans.

A Rise in Gaming Leaks

The gaming industry has recently witnessed a surge in leaks, with numerous companies facing similar challenges. Notable instances include Sony’s unintentional disclosure of the Legacy of Kain remaster and circulating images of the rumored Nintendo Switch 2. Other significant leaks this year have encompassed the PlayStation 5 Pro and the new Warzone map for Call of Duty: Black Ops 6, highlighting a growing trend of information slipping through the cracks ahead of official announcements.

This rise in gaming leaks underscores the challenges companies face in maintaining secrecy around their most anticipated projects. As fans eagerly await official announcements, these inadvertent revelations continue to stir excitement and speculation within the gaming community.
